Red Cherry Shrimp 4K HD Wallpapers:

Red Cherry Shrimp is one of the famous shrimps. They originate from Taiwan & are available in vibrant color. They need low care & are best suited for new hobbyists.

Red Cherry Shrimps are peaceful & they can live from 1 to 2 years in aquariums. They grow up to 1.5 inches in length. They are omnivorous. They need a tank size of 5 gallons. They can live with other peaceful fish, shrimps & snails.

Red Cherry Shrimps feed on algae & other foods. They like heavily planted aquariums with abundance of hiding places. Most of the time they will graze on the plants, gravels etc. You can also keep Red Cherry Shrimp in a pond.

Freshwater Snails 4K HD Wallpapers:

Many types of snails do not need high care, & several species can live happily in small aquariums. It is fun to see them doing their tasks & they have their own personality. They look quite different from fish & they can swim & crawl. They don’t have fins like fish.

Snails are commonly found in the aquarium hobby. They are available in many colors & sizes. They live peacefully in aquariums except Assassin snails that will eat other types of snails. They will eat algae growing in the aquarium water.

Snails eat algae, & leftover food that sink to the bottom of the aquarium.
